diff options
author | max <max@FreeBSD.org> | 1998-09-01 00:09:19 +0800 |
---|---|---|
committer | max <max@FreeBSD.org> | 1998-09-01 00:09:19 +0800 |
commit | 2b41d4777295d5374c222757b16051366c496d3c (patch) | |
tree | 67df00d886a9ad997fbc4c1a69a5a82694b37796 /japanese/okphone | |
parent | 6da12660841de002bb5a552647fe8fa9166af5c9 (diff) | |
download | freebsd-ports-gnome-2b41d4777295d5374c222757b16051366c496d3c.tar.gz freebsd-ports-gnome-2b41d4777295d5374c222757b16051366c496d3c.tar.zst freebsd-ports-gnome-2b41d4777295d5374c222757b16051366c496d3c.zip |
Reorganize this port a bit:
- Split a big patch-aa into five pieces.
- Don't patch up the dist Makefile to install and compress the man
page.
- Define MAN1 and remove man page entry from the PLIST.
- Make myself the maintainer (was ports@FreeBSD.ORG).
- Install the docs into share/doc/okphone instead of share/okphone.
- Honor ${NOPORTDOCS}.
There might be some other changes I can't remember of.
Diffstat (limited to 'japanese/okphone')
-rw-r--r-- | japanese/okphone/Makefile | 15 | ||||
-rw-r--r-- | japanese/okphone/files/patch-aa | 88 | ||||
-rw-r--r-- | japanese/okphone/files/patch-ab | 28 | ||||
-rw-r--r-- | japanese/okphone/files/patch-ac | 29 | ||||
-rw-r--r-- | japanese/okphone/files/patch-ad | 11 | ||||
-rw-r--r-- | japanese/okphone/files/patch-ae | 11 | ||||
-rw-r--r-- | japanese/okphone/pkg-plist | 7 |
7 files changed, 96 insertions, 93 deletions
diff --git a/japanese/okphone/Makefile b/japanese/okphone/Makefile index 140439e4f925..850333a09306 100644 --- a/japanese/okphone/Makefile +++ b/japanese/okphone/Makefile @@ -3,7 +3,7 @@ # Date created: 7 February 1996 # Whom: asami # -# $Id: Makefile,v 1.10 1997/12/25 22:29:40 asami Exp $ +# $Id: Makefile,v 1.11 1998/08/10 12:10:07 steve Exp $ # DISTNAME= okphone-1.2 @@ -13,11 +13,20 @@ MASTER_SITES= ftp://ftp.kyushu-u.ac.jp/pub/utils/ PATCH_SITES= ftp://ftp.fit.ac.jp/pub/Net/okphone/patch/ PATCHFILES= okphone-1.2.FreeBSD-patch.rev2.gz -PATCH_DIST_STRIP= -p1 -MAINTAINER= ports@FreeBSD.ORG +MAINTAINER= max@FreeBSD.ORG + +PATCH_DIST_STRIP= -p1 +MAN1= phone.1 post-install: + ${INSTALL_MAN} ${WRKSRC}/phone.1 ${PREFIX}/man/man1 +.if !defined(NOPORTDOCS) + ${MKDIR} ${PREFIX}/share/doc/okphone +.for f in NOTE READ_ME Readme.kana + ${INSTALL_DATA} ${WRKSRC}/$f ${PREFIX}/share/doc/okphone +.endfor +.endif @${SH} ${PKGDIR}/INSTALL ${PKGNAME} POST-INSTALL .include <bsd.port.mk> diff --git a/japanese/okphone/files/patch-aa b/japanese/okphone/files/patch-aa index 478146aff9de..7c9afc7d59f2 100644 --- a/japanese/okphone/files/patch-aa +++ b/japanese/okphone/files/patch-aa @@ -5,7 +5,7 @@ CC = cc -CFLAGS = -O -+CFLAGS += ++CFLAGS += -O SRCS = convd.c DEST = convd -RDEST = /usr/local/etc/convd @@ -18,91 +18,7 @@ install: ${DEST} /bin/rm -f ${RDEST} - cp ${DEST} ${RDEST} -+ install -cs ${DEST} ${RDEST} ++ install -cs -m 755 -o bin -g bin ${DEST} ${RDEST} clean: /bin/rm -f ${DEST} core *.o ---- ./client/Makefile.org Wed Feb 7 18:45:34 1996 -+++ ./client/Makefile Wed Feb 7 18:45:36 1996 -@@ -20,14 +20,14 @@ - CC = cc - #CFLAGS = -O -DSERVICES -DLOCAL_ECHO - #CFLAGS = -g -DSERVICES -DLOCAL_ECHO --CFLAGS = -Isw -O -DSERVICES -DLOCAL_ECHO -+CFLAGS += -Isw -DSERVICES -DLOCAL_ECHO - #LIBS = -lcurses -ltermlib #-lresolv - LIBS = sw/libsw.a -ltermlib -ll - - LPR = lpr -Psony - #RDEST = /usr/ucb/phone - #RDEST = /usr/local/phone --RDEST = /usr/local/bin/phone -+RDEST = ${PREFIX}/bin/phone - - HDRS = defs.h - -@@ -69,7 +69,7 @@ - - install: ${DEST} - /bin/rm -f ${RDEST} -- cp ${DEST} ${RDEST} -+ install -cs ${DEST} ${RDEST} - - print: ${HDRS} ${SRCS} - pr -f ${HDRS} ${SRCS} | expand -4 | ${LPR} ---- ./master/Makefile.org Wed Feb 7 18:45:36 1996 -+++ ./master/Makefile Wed Feb 7 18:45:36 1996 -@@ -29,7 +29,7 @@ - #CFLAGS = -O -DSERVICES -DDPATH=\"$(CONVD)\" -DFORK - #CFLAGS = -O -DINETD -DDPATH=\"$(CONVD)\" - #CFLAGS = -O -DINETD -DDPATH=\"$(CONVD)\" -DSERVICES --CFLAGS = $(OFLAG) $(INETD) -DFORK -DSERVICES -DDPATH=\"/usr/local/etc/convd\" -+CFLAGS += $(INETD) -DFORK -DSERVICES -DDPATH=\"${PREFIX}/libexec/convd\" - - LPR = lpr -Psony - CC = cc -@@ -44,7 +44,7 @@ - reinvite.o strsave.o utmp.o - - DEST = phoned --RDEST = /usr/local/etc/in.phoned -+RDEST = ${PREFIX}/libexec/phoned - #RDEST = /etc/phoned - - -@@ -61,7 +61,7 @@ - - install: ${DEST} - /bin/rm -f ${RDEST} -- cp ${DEST} ${RDEST} -+ install -cs ${DEST} ${RDEST} - - clean: - /bin/rm -f ${DEST} core *.o ---- ./Makefile.org Fri Dec 15 01:30:07 1989 -+++ ./Makefile Wed Feb 7 20:39:53 1996 -@@ -13,3 +13,13 @@ - done - - default: all -+ -+install: -+ /bin/rm -f ${PREFIX}/man/man1/phone.1* -+ install -c phone.1 ${PREFIX}/man/man1 -+ gzip -9nf ${PREFIX}/man/man1/phone.1 -+ mkdir -p ${PREFIX}/share/okphone -+ install -c NOTE READ_ME Readme.kana ${PREFIX}/share/okphone -+ for i in ${DIRS} ; do \ -+ cd $$i ; make MFLAGS="${MFLAGS}" $@ ; cd .. ; \ -+ done ---- ./client/sw/Makefile.org Fri Dec 15 01:30:11 1989 -+++ ./client/sw/Makefile Wed Feb 7 20:57:50 1996 -@@ -1,7 +1,7 @@ - # $Header: /home/ncvs/ports/japanese/okphone/patches/patch-aa,v 1.2 1996/02/08 05:01:24 asami Exp $ - - #CFLAGS= -g -pg --CFLAGS= -O -+CFLAGS+= - objs= winit.o wcreate.o woutput.o wredraw.o wput.o wclear.o wbox.o wbell.o\ - tosjis.o - srcs= winit.c wcreate.c woutput.c wredraw.c wput.c wclear.c wbox.c wbell.c\ diff --git a/japanese/okphone/files/patch-ab b/japanese/okphone/files/patch-ab new file mode 100644 index 000000000000..244c705bc97b --- /dev/null +++ b/japanese/okphone/files/patch-ab @@ -0,0 +1,28 @@ +--- ./client/Makefile.org Wed Feb 7 18:45:34 1996 ++++ ./client/Makefile Wed Feb 7 18:45:36 1996 +@@ -20,14 +20,14 @@ + CC = cc + #CFLAGS = -O -DSERVICES -DLOCAL_ECHO + #CFLAGS = -g -DSERVICES -DLOCAL_ECHO +-CFLAGS = -Isw -O -DSERVICES -DLOCAL_ECHO ++CFLAGS += -Isw -O -DSERVICES -DLOCAL_ECHO + #LIBS = -lcurses -ltermlib #-lresolv + LIBS = sw/libsw.a -ltermlib -ll + + LPR = lpr -Psony + #RDEST = /usr/ucb/phone + #RDEST = /usr/local/phone +-RDEST = /usr/local/bin/phone ++RDEST = ${PREFIX}/bin/phone + + HDRS = defs.h + +@@ -69,7 +69,7 @@ + + install: ${DEST} + /bin/rm -f ${RDEST} +- cp ${DEST} ${RDEST} ++ install -cs -m 755 -o bin -g bin ${DEST} ${RDEST} + + print: ${HDRS} ${SRCS} + pr -f ${HDRS} ${SRCS} | expand -4 | ${LPR} diff --git a/japanese/okphone/files/patch-ac b/japanese/okphone/files/patch-ac new file mode 100644 index 000000000000..6f922dfb3a41 --- /dev/null +++ b/japanese/okphone/files/patch-ac @@ -0,0 +1,29 @@ +--- ./master/Makefile.org Wed Feb 7 18:45:36 1996 ++++ ./master/Makefile Wed Feb 7 18:45:36 1996 +@@ -29,7 +29,7 @@ + #CFLAGS = -O -DSERVICES -DDPATH=\"$(CONVD)\" -DFORK + #CFLAGS = -O -DINETD -DDPATH=\"$(CONVD)\" + #CFLAGS = -O -DINETD -DDPATH=\"$(CONVD)\" -DSERVICES +-CFLAGS = $(OFLAG) $(INETD) -DFORK -DSERVICES -DDPATH=\"/usr/local/etc/convd\" ++CFLAGS += $(OFLAGS) $(INETD) -DFORK -DSERVICES -DDPATH=\"${PREFIX}/libexec/convd\" + + LPR = lpr -Psony + CC = cc +@@ -44,7 +44,7 @@ + reinvite.o strsave.o utmp.o + + DEST = phoned +-RDEST = /usr/local/etc/in.phoned ++RDEST = ${PREFIX}/libexec/phoned + #RDEST = /etc/phoned + + +@@ -61,7 +61,7 @@ + + install: ${DEST} + /bin/rm -f ${RDEST} +- cp ${DEST} ${RDEST} ++ install -cs -m 755 -o bin -g bin ${DEST} ${RDEST} + + clean: + /bin/rm -f ${DEST} core *.o diff --git a/japanese/okphone/files/patch-ad b/japanese/okphone/files/patch-ad new file mode 100644 index 000000000000..b0408bbb2e6c --- /dev/null +++ b/japanese/okphone/files/patch-ad @@ -0,0 +1,11 @@ +--- ./Makefile.org Fri Dec 15 01:30:07 1989 ++++ ./Makefile Wed Feb 7 20:39:53 1996 +@@ -13,3 +13,8 @@ + done + + default: all ++ ++install: ++ for i in ${DIRS} ; do \ ++ cd $$i ; make MFLAGS="${MFLAGS}" $@ ; cd .. ; \ ++ done diff --git a/japanese/okphone/files/patch-ae b/japanese/okphone/files/patch-ae new file mode 100644 index 000000000000..0790fdbf8145 --- /dev/null +++ b/japanese/okphone/files/patch-ae @@ -0,0 +1,11 @@ +--- ./client/sw/Makefile.org Fri Dec 15 01:30:11 1989 ++++ ./client/sw/Makefile Wed Feb 7 20:57:50 1996 +@@ -1,7 +1,7 @@ + # $Header: /home/ncvs/ports/japanese/okphone/patches/patch-aa,v 1.3 1996/02/08 06:27:36 asami Exp $ + + #CFLAGS= -g -pg +-CFLAGS= -O ++CFLAGS+= -O + objs= winit.o wcreate.o woutput.o wredraw.o wput.o wclear.o wbox.o wbell.o\ + tosjis.o + srcs= winit.c wcreate.c woutput.c wredraw.c wput.c wclear.c wbox.c wbell.c\ diff --git a/japanese/okphone/pkg-plist b/japanese/okphone/pkg-plist index fc4879643a06..9ecf15447400 100644 --- a/japanese/okphone/pkg-plist +++ b/japanese/okphone/pkg-plist @@ -1,7 +1,6 @@ bin/phone -man/man1/phone.1.gz libexec/phoned libexec/convd -share/okphone/NOTE -share/okphone/READ_ME -share/okphone/Readme.kana +share/doc/okphone/NOTE +share/doc/okphone/READ_ME +share/doc/okphone/Readme.kana |